Diego Pavia, the former Vanderbilt quarterback and 2025 Heisman runner-up, went undrafted in the 2026 NFL Draft before signing a three-year deal with the Baltimore Ravens as an undrafted free agent. Trader consensus now shows a narrow edge for him failing to secure a spot on the 53-man roster by Week 1, reflecting his 5-foot-10 frame, questions about arm strength, and the Ravens' established depth behind Lamar Jackson and Tyler Huntley. Recent reports highlight his polarizing personality and self-representation as potential factors limiting early camp opportunities, yet his college production and athletic profile keep the market balanced. Preseason performance, injury developments, and final roster decisions during training camp remain the primary variables that could shift implied probabilities in either direction ahead of the regular season.
